What is there to see and do in Malton?
Spend some time experiencing the great outdoors at Scampston Walled Garden and Howardian Hills. During your stay, visit sights such as Eden Camp Modern History Theme Museum, Flamingo Land Theme Park and Zoo and Malton and Norton Golf Club. Travellers love Malton for its bar scene.
When is the best time to book a hotel with a pool in Malton?
Taking the local weather in Malton into account is an important factor for planning your visit, especially if you plan to spend your trip by the pool. The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 14°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 4°C. Average annual precipitation for Malton is 783 mm.
What's the best way to travel around Malton?
Knowing the transportation options in and around Malton can help you enjoy the area beyond your hotel pool. If you want to venture outside the area, hop aboard a train at Malton Station. Malton might not have very many public transport options to choose from, so consider a car rental to maximise your time.
